Flatbed towing for EVs and AWD

Sunnyvale is EV country, and electric and all-wheel-drive vehicles need a flatbed. Towing an EV on its drive wheels can damage the motor and the regen system, and AWD cars can be harmed if a pair of wheels is dragged. A flatbed carries the whole vehicle on a level deck with nothing turning. The same is true for low-clearance and lowered cars. You do not have to know which truck you need: tell the operator the make and model, and they bring the one that fits.

  • Flatbed: the safest choice for EVs, AWD and 4WD, low cars, and anything badly damaged. Nothing drags, and the drivetrain is protected.
  • Wheel-lift: quick and well suited to many standard front- or rear-wheel-drive tows over shorter distances.

Winch-outs and stuck vehicles

Sometimes the vehicle is not broken, it is just stuck. A car drops a wheel off a soft shoulder, slides in a winter downpour, or wedges where it cannot back out. A winch-out uses the truck's cable to pull the vehicle free without tearing up the undercarriage. Once it is back on solid ground, the operator checks that it is drivable or loads it up if it is not.

Motorcycles, trucks, and more

Towing is not just for sedans. Motorcycles need special straps and a soft tie-down so the bike is not scratched or tipped. Pickups, full-size SUVs, and work vans need a truck rated for the weight. When you call, name the vehicle so the dispatcher sends equipment that matches it.
